Dexter's Story
** If you are interested in adopting Dexter please fill out our adoption application at http://farfels.com/farfels-rescue/adoption-form/ **<br/><br/>Dexter is an 3 year old, 8 lb Chihuahua. He is a sweet, shy young guy who is making sense of all the big changes in his life right now, including losing his home and finding himself in a shelter environment.<br/><br/>Dexter came to us from a shelter in New Mexico after his owner sadly passed away. He was surrendered alongside about 8 other dogs he had been living with. Given the condition of the group (all not fixed, one pregnant, four young puppies), it’s likely Dexter previously came from a situation more like an unregulated breeding environment. The good news is that he is now safely out of that life and getting the chance to start fresh.<br/><br/>Dexter does wonderfully with other dogs and seems to take comfort and confidence from their presence. Because of this, we are requiring he go to a home with another small, friendly dog.<br/><br/>From Dexter's foster:<br/>"Dexter is the biggest lover!! It took him about 5 days until he fully warmed up, and he was a bit timid of us for those first few days, but once he warmed up he changed into the BIGGEST snuggle bug and affection-seeker!<br/>He is more on the mellow side and spends majority of the day curled up under a blankie and snuggling with one of us or my other foster dog.<br/>He is starting to dabble in playing as of recently! But still prefers to cuddle over play.<br/>Ever since he warmed up and started letting us put his leash on him to take him out on walks, he hasn't had any accidents inside and knows to go right when we get outside!<br/>He barks when we leave the house, so he probably shouldn't go to an apartment with a shared wall, but he's never chewed anything or anything when we leave.<br/>He loves our other foster dog, another Chihuahua, and I know he would just thrive in a home with another dog.<br/>He also sleeps in the crate through out the whole night!"<br/><br/><br/>Dexter is up to date on his vaccinations, has been fully vetted, is healthy, heartworm negative, and is neutered.<br/><br/>Farfel's Rescue is a fully foster based rescue, and offers a one week trial with every adoption. We feel that this is much more beneficial to not only the dog, but the adopter too. We believe that only getting 20-30 minutes with a dog before deciding on a lifetime commitment is not a fair amount of time to the adopter, or the dog. Therefore we give adopters one week with the dog to assure it is the right fit, and offer a full refund of their adoption fee should it not workout within the week trial.<br/><br/>Farfel's Rescue has been doing adoptions this way since 2005 and is thrilled to adopt out ~400 dogs each year.<br/><br/>Applications are currently being accepted for our wonderful pup.
